The Most Common Traditional Chinese Words

Traditional Chinese words ranked 8,601–8,700 by frequency. Continue from where the previous page left off.

  1. #8,612合資hé zī·ㄏㄜˊ ㄗjoint venture; pooling capital with others to run a business together.
  2. #8,613戰事zhàn shì·ㄓㄢˋ ㄕˋwar; armed conflict; hostilities; military fighting.
  3. #8,614陝西省shǎn xī shěng·ㄕㄢˇ ㄒㄧ ㄕㄥˇShaanxi Province; a province in northwest China, capital Xi'an; historically significant as the heartland of ancient Chinese civilization.
  4. #8,615代表作dài biǎo zuò·ㄉㄞˋ ㄅㄧㄠˇ ㄗㄨㄛˋa representative work of an author or artist; the work that best represents someone's highest achievement or artistic style
  5. #8,616以利yǐ lì·ㄧˇ ㄌㄧˋin order to; so as to; for the purpose of; used to introduce a goal or benefit.
  6. #8,617清軍qīng jūn·ㄑㄧㄥ ㄐㄩㄣthe army of the Qing dynasty (1644–1912); Qing military forces
  7. #8,618從政cóng zhèng·ㄘㄨㄥˊ ㄓㄥˋto engage in politics; to participate in government; to hold public office
  8. #8,619報社bàoshè·ㄅㄠˋ ㄕㄜˋa company that edits and publishes newspapers; a newspaper publisher
  9. #8,620好聽hǎo tīng·ㄏㄠˇ ㄊㄧㄥpleasant to hear; melodious; sounds good; (of content) engaging, compelling, or well-expressed.
  10. #8,621拍拍pāi pai·ㄆㄞ ˙ㄆㄞto pat or clap repeatedly; to have a chat; (onomatopoeia) the flapping sound of bird wings
  11. #8,622明智míngzhì·ㄇㄧㄥˊ ㄓˋwise; sensible; having good judgment and foresight.
  12. #8,623低收入戶dī shōu rù hù·ㄉㄧ ㄕㄡ ㄖㄨˋ ㄏㄨˋlow-income household; a family whose total income falls below a set threshold; in Taiwan, classified by degree of need under social assistance rules
  13. #8,624在野zài yě·ㄗㄞˋ ㄧㄝˇout of political office; not in power; (of a party) in opposition
  14. #8,625婉拒wǎn jù·ㄨㄢˇ ㄐㄩˋto politely decline; to turn down in a tactful, gentle way
  15. #8,626漆黑qī hēi·ㄑㄧ ㄏㄟpitch-black; extremely dark; jet-black; completely without light
  16. #8,627漫遊màn yóu·ㄇㄢˋ ㄧㄡˊto roam; to wander freely; to travel around; (mobile telephony) roaming
  17. #8,628線路xiànlù·ㄒㄧㄢˋ ㄌㄨˋelectrical circuit or wire; a narrow path or track; a route; a clue or lead (in Taiwan usage).
  18. #8,629質地zhí dì·ㄓˊ ㄉㄧˋtexture; the inherent quality or character of a material; the essential nature of a substance.
  19. #8,630宮女gōng nǚ·ㄍㄨㄥ ㄋㄩˇpalace maid; a woman servant in a palace or royal household.
  20. #8,631拉抬lā tái·ㄌㄚ ㄊㄞˊto pull something up; to give a boost to; to support
  21. #8,632性能xìngnéng·ㄒㄧㄥˋ ㄋㄥˊperformance; how well something functions; capability; behavior of a system or device
  22. #8,633示意shì yì·ㄕˋ ㄧˋto hint; to indicate an idea to someone; to convey meaning through expression, gesture, or words
  23. #8,634學年xuénián·ㄒㄩㄝˊ ㄋㄧㄢˊacademic year; school year; the annual period into which a school's program is divided, typically running from autumn to the following summer.
  24. #8,635偏低piān dī·ㄆㄧㄢ ㄉㄧbelow the standard or expected level; on the low side; lower than average or adequate
  25. #8,636誓言shì yán·ㄕˋ ㄧㄢˊa solemn promise or vow; a pledge made with strong resolve; an oath
  26. #8,637服務生fú wù shēng·ㄈㄨˊ ㄨˋ ㄕㄥa server; a person who serves the public in places like restaurants or other service venues.
  27. #8,638通緝tōngqì·ㄊㄨㄥ ㄑㄧˋto issue a warrant for someone's arrest; to list as wanted; to order a manhunt for a fugitive
  28. #8,639阿美族ā měi zú·ㄚ ㄇㄟˇ ㄗㄨˊAmis or Pangcah, an indigenous people of Taiwan; traditionally matrilineal, with agriculture-based livelihood and animist rituals such as harvest festivals.
  29. #8,640匱乏kuì fá·ㄎㄨㄟˋ ㄈㄚˊto be lacking or short of something such as supplies or money; scarcity; poverty
  30. #8,641成敗chéngbài·ㄔㄥˊ ㄅㄞˋsuccess or failure; outcome of an endeavor; to cause failure
  31. #8,642方才fāng cái·ㄈㄤ ㄘㄞˊjust now; a moment ago; only then; not until that point
  32. #8,643死亡率sǐ wáng lǜ·ㄙˇ ㄨㄤˊ ㄌㄩˋmortality rate; death rate; the proportion of deaths in a population over a given period.
  33. #8,644民粹mín cuì·ㄇㄧㄣˊ ㄘㄨㄟˋpopulism; political approach claiming to represent ordinary people against elites; sometimes used pejoratively for demagoguery.
  34. #8,645迫不及待pò bù jí dài·ㄆㄛˋ ㄅㄨˋ ㄐㄧˊ ㄉㄞˋtoo impatient to wait; unable to hold oneself back; eager to do something without delay
  35. #8,646還原huán yuán·ㄏㄨㄢˊ ㄩㄢˊto restore to the original state; to reconstruct (an event); reduction (chemistry)
  36. #8,647音響yīnxiǎng·ㄧㄣ ㄒㄧㄤˇsound; acoustics; audio equipment; hi-fi or stereo system; sound effects in performance art
  37. #8,648牛排niúpái·ㄋㄧㄡˊ ㄆㄞˊsteak; a thick slice of beef, typically pan-fried or grilled.
  38. #8,649致使zhì shǐ·ㄓˋ ㄕˇto cause; to result in; to bring about; to lead to
  39. #8,650奔波bēn bō·ㄅㄣ ㄅㄛto rush about; to be constantly on the move; to hustle; to run around busy
  40. #8,651考古kǎogǔ·ㄎㄠˇ ㄍㄨˇarchaeology; the study of ancient human history and culture through excavation and analysis of artifacts and ruins.
  41. #8,652軌跡guǐ jī·ㄍㄨㄟˇ ㄐㄧtrack; trail; path left behind; locus; orbit; trajectory; in mathematics, the path traced by a moving point or curve under given conditions.
  42. #8,653甚至於shèn zhì yú·ㄕㄣˋ ㄓˋ ㄩˊso much that; even to the extent that; even
  43. #8,654著想zháoxiǎngto consider others' needs; to think of others; to plan; to intend
  44. #8,655依附yī fù·ㄧ ㄈㄨˋto depend on; to attach oneself to; to be subordinate to; to rely on for support.
  45. #8,656官職guān zhí·ㄍㄨㄢ ㄓˊan official position in government; a bureaucratic post; a government office or rank
  46. #8,657將要jiāngyào·ㄐㄧㄤ ㄧㄠˋwill; shall; to be going to; about to happen soon; on the verge of.
  47. #8,658不休bù xiū·ㄅㄨˋ ㄒㄧㄡwithout rest; ceaselessly; endlessly; incessantly
  48. #8,659牡丹mǔ dān·ㄇㄨˇ ㄉㄢtree peony (Paeonia suffruticosa); a deciduous shrub with large flowers in red, white, yellow, or purple; native to China
  49. #8,660衝進chōng jìn·ㄔㄨㄥ ㄐㄧㄣˋto rush in; to charge in; to burst into a place quickly
  50. #8,661調適tiáo shì·ㄊㄧㄠˊ ㄕˋto adapt; to adjust to new conditions or environments; psychological adaptation where existing cognitive structures are modified to accommodate new stimuli and maintain equilibrium.
  51. #8,662震盪zhèn dàng·ㄓㄣˋ ㄉㄤˋto shake; to jolt; to vibrate; to oscillate; to fluctuate
  52. #8,663領悟lǐngwù·ㄌㄧㄥˇ ㄨˋto understand deeply; to grasp the meaning of something after reflection.
  53. #8,664水管shuǐ guǎn·ㄕㄨㄟˇ ㄍㄨㄢˇwater pipe; tube or conduit for carrying water; (slang, Taiwan) fire hydrant
  54. #8,665演變成yǎn biàn chéng·ㄧㄢˇ ㄅㄧㄢˋ ㄔㄥˊto evolve into; to develop into; to turn into; to escalate into (a situation or state).
  55. #8,666蒼蠅cāngyíng·ㄘㄤ ㄧㄥˊhousefly; a common flying insect often found around garbage and food; in Chinese culture, sometimes used metaphorically to describe a minor but annoying person
  56. #8,667反之fǎnzhī·ㄈㄢˇ ㄓon the other hand; conversely; the opposite is true; in contrast.
  57. #8,668迷宮mígōng·ㄇㄧˊ ㄍㄨㄥmaze; labyrinth; a confusing or intricate situation that is hard to navigate or resolve
  58. #8,669傳教士chuán jiào shì·ㄔㄨㄢˊ ㄐㄧㄠˋ ㄕˋmissionary; a person who spreads religious teachings, especially one sent to promote faith in another region.
  59. #8,670肺癌fèi yán·ㄈㄟˋ ㄧㄢˊlung cancer; a malignant tumor of the lung, often linked to smoking or air pollution; treated with surgery, chemotherapy, or targeted therapy.
  60. #8,671尚書shàng shū·ㄕㄤˋ ㄕㄨhigh-ranking government minister in imperial China; one of the heads of the Six Ministries under the Department of State Affairs; Book of Documents (alternate name for the Classic of History)
  61. #8,672延燒yán shāo·ㄧㄢˊ ㄕㄠ(of fire) to keep burning; to spread to other areas; (fig.) (of disease, conflict, trend) to spread; to intensify
  62. #8,673廿四niàn sì·ㄋㄧㄢˋ ㄙˋtwenty-four; 24; used in formal or literary Chinese to denote the number twenty-four
  63. #8,674改名gǎi míng·ㄍㄞˇ ㄇㄧㄥˊto change one's name; to rename
  64. #8,675華視huá shì·ㄏㄨㄚˊ ㄕˋChinese Television System (CTS); major public TV broadcaster in Taiwan.
  65. #8,676隨行suí xíng·ㄙㄨㄟˊ ㄒㄧㄥˊto accompany; to go along with; to follow someone as they travel or move.
  66. #8,677領到lǐng dào·ㄌㄧㄥˇ ㄉㄠˋto receive; to get; to obtain (something given or distributed)
  67. #8,678河岸hé àn·ㄏㄜˊ ㄢˋthe bank of a river; the land along the edge of a river.
  68. #8,679天色tiān sè·ㄊㄧㄢ ㄙㄜˋcolor of the sky; time of day as shown by the sky's color; weather
  69. #8,680寂靜jí jìng·ㄐㄧˊ ㄐㄧㄥˋquiet; silent; still; hushed; devoid of sound
  70. #8,681爭取到zhēng qǔ dào·ㄓㄥ ㄑㄩˇ ㄉㄠˋto secure or obtain through effort; to win over; to gain by striving.
  71. #8,682蔣經國jiǎng jīng guó·ㄐㄧㄤˇ ㄐㄧㄥ ㄍㄨㄛˊChiang Ching-kuo (1910–1988), son of Chiang Kai-shek; Guomindang politician; president of the Republic of China (Taiwan) from 1978 to 1988.
  72. #8,683轉化為zhuǎn huà wèi·ㄓㄨㄢˇ ㄏㄨㄚˋ ㄨㄟˋto transform into; to convert into; to change from one form or state into another
  73. #8,684獻上xiàn shàng·ㄒㄧㄢˋ ㄕㄤˋto offer respectfully; to present formally; to dedicate; to contribute as a gift or tribute
  74. #8,685燈泡dēng pào·ㄉㄥ ㄆㄠˋlight bulb; (slang) third wheel, unwanted companion on a couple's date.
  75. #8,686功臣gōng chén·ㄍㄨㄥ ㄔㄣˊa person who renders exceptional service; a meritorious official; a hero; (fig.) something that plays a vital role
  76. #8,687哎呀āiyā·ㄞ ㄧㄚinterjection expressing surprise, shock, worry, annoyance, or admiration; 'oh no', 'oh dear', 'wow'
  77. #8,688旅人lǚ rén·ㄌㄩˇ ㄖㄣˊtraveler; a person on a journey; (archaic) an official in charge of food preparation.
  78. #8,689布萊恩bù lái ēn·ㄅㄨˋ ㄌㄞˊ ㄣBrian (male given name)
  79. #8,690活生生huó shēng shēng·ㄏㄨㄛˊ ㄕㄥ ㄕㄥreal; vivid; lifelike; while still alive; in the flesh
  80. #8,691大夥dà huǒ·ㄉㄚˋ ㄏㄨㄛˇa large group of people; a crowd; (archaic) bandits, robbers
  81. #8,692艱困jiān kùn·ㄐㄧㄢ ㄎㄨㄣˋdifficult and hard; arduous; beset by hardship.
  82. #8,693怎會zěn huì·ㄗㄣˇ ㄏㄨㄟˋhow could; how is it that; expresses surprise or disbelief about something happening.
  83. #8,694自律zì lǜ·ㄗˋ ㄌㄩˋself-discipline; self-regulation; the ability to control and manage one's own behavior; autonomy in ethics; autonomic in physiology
  84. #8,695增多zēng duō·ㄗㄥ ㄉㄨㄛto increase; to grow in number; to become more numerous.
  85. #8,696效用xiào yòng·ㄒㄧㄠˋ ㄩㄥˋusefulness; effectiveness; (economics) utility; efficacy and function; service rendered
  86. #8,697開庭kāi tíng·ㄎㄞ ㄊㄧㄥˊto begin a court session; to hold a court hearing; to convene a trial
  87. #8,698心愛xīnài·ㄒㄧㄣ ㄞˋbeloved; most loved; cherished; dearly loved
  88. #8,699發電廠fā diàn chǎng·ㄈㄚ ㄉㄧㄢˋ ㄔㄤˇpower plant; facility that generates electricity, such as a hydroelectric, thermal, wind, solar, or nuclear power plant.
  89. #8,700而今ér jīn·ㄦˊ ㄐㄧㄣnow; at present; nowadays; these days.
  90. #8,701告誡gào jiè·ㄍㄠˋ ㄐㄧㄝˋto warn; to admonish; to caution someone about their behavior or actions
  91. #8,702流露liú lù·ㄌㄧㄡˊ ㄌㄨˋto reveal indirectly or unintentionally; to show feelings, attitudes, or qualities through behavior, tone, or expression
  92. #8,703葡萄酒pú táo jiǔ·ㄆㄨˊ ㄊㄠˊ ㄐㄧㄡˇwine made from grapes; includes red, white, and sweet varieties.
  93. #8,704警惕jǐngtì·ㄐㄧㄥˇ ㄊㄧˋto be vigilant; to stay alert; to warn someone to be cautious; to keep on guard against danger or mistakes
  94. #8,705病床bìngchuáng·ㄅㄧㄥˋ ㄔㄨㄤˊhospital bed; sickbed; a bed for a patient in a medical facility.
  95. #8,706世界盃shì jiè bēi·ㄕˋ ㄐㄧㄝˋ ㄅㄟWorld Cup; FIFA World Cup; major international football (soccer) tournament held every four years.
  96. #8,707台資tái zī·ㄊㄞˊ ㄗTaiwan-funded capital; investment from Taiwan; capital or enterprises originating from Taiwan.
  97. #8,708填補tián bǔ·ㄊㄧㄢˊ ㄅㄨˇto fill a gap; to make up a deficiency; to fill in a blank on a form
  98. #8,709水手shuǐ shǒu·ㄕㄨㄟˇ ㄕㄡˇsailor; seaman; mariner; (in Taiwan) navy sailor, seaman
  99. #8,710關掉guān diào·ㄍㄨㄢ ㄉㄧㄠˋto switch off; to shut off; to turn off (a device, light, or appliance).
  100. #8,711上人shàng rén·ㄕㄤˋ ㄖㄣˊa person of superior moral wisdom; a respected senior monk or Buddhist clergy; a master or person of high status.

Frequency is derived from the COCT 通用詞頻表, a traditional-script word-frequency corpus published by Taiwan's National Academy for Educational Research. Every entry links to its full page — reading, meaning, and the characters that make it up.
